About

Stone Fortress Wealth Strategies provides fiduciary investment management and financial planning primarily to high‑net‑worth individuals and retirement plans. The firm manages about $56.1 million for a concentrated roster of roughly 28 clients and offers project‑based, ongoing and hourly planning engagements alongside discretionary and non‑discretionary portfolio management.

The firm’s investment process emphasizes fundamental analysis and a generally long‑term approach, with portfolios built from low‑cost mutual funds and ETFs and the selective use of individual stocks, bonds and alternatives. Stone Fortress also uses options and other derivatives within separately managed accounts and conducts ongoing monitoring with at least annual formal reviews plus monthly meetings and ad‑hoc support for plan implementation.

What is distinctive about Stone Fortress is its combination of a small, three‑advisor team and a concentrated client base—about $2 million in assets per client—along with an explicit willingness to employ derivatives in customized accounts, a practice that is uncommon among peers. The firm couples in‑house financial planning with investment management and operates through an institutional custodial platform to support its tailored, high‑net‑worth focus.

Fee options

Fixed

Fixed fees for initial, project-based financial planning engagements up to $2,500; ongoing financial planning fees up to $12,000 per year.

Percentage

$0 - $1,000,000: 1.20% $1,000,001 - $5,000,000: 1.00% $5,000,001 - $10,000,000: 0.75% $10,000,001+: 0.50%

Project-based

Up to $500 per hour for ad-hoc financial planning projects.

Other

Account minimum: Stone Fortress generally does not impose a minimum relationship size. Fee-only: Fixed fees for financial planning up to $2,500; ongoing financial planning fees up to $12,000 per year; hourly fees up to $500 per hour.

Daniel Glod is a CFP® and ChFC® with 22 years of industry experience. He is currently with Stone Fortress Wealth Strategies and has held prior roles at DDMT Financial Services, High Speed Alliance, Coventry First, TIAA-CREF Individual & Institutional Services, and PNC Investments. Outside of finance, he owns an auto repair business, Millevoi Brothers Auto Repair, which he has managed since 2014.
